ARM: 7104/1: plat-pxa: break out GPIO driver specifics
The <mach/gpio.h> file is included from upper directories and deal with generic GPIO and gpiolib stuff. Break out the platform and driver specific defines and functions into its own header file. Cc: Eric Miao <eric.y.miao@gmail.com> Signed-off-by:Linus Walleij <linus.walleij@linaro.org> Signed-off-by:
Russell King <rmk+kernel@arm.linux.org.uk>
Showing
- arch/arm/mach-mmp/aspenite.c 1 addition, 0 deletionsarch/arm/mach-mmp/aspenite.c
- arch/arm/mach-mmp/brownstone.c 0 additions, 1 deletionarch/arm/mach-mmp/brownstone.c
- arch/arm/mach-mmp/gplugd.c 1 addition, 1 deletionarch/arm/mach-mmp/gplugd.c
- arch/arm/mach-mmp/include/mach/gpio-pxa.h 30 additions, 0 deletionsarch/arm/mach-mmp/include/mach/gpio-pxa.h
- arch/arm/mach-mmp/include/mach/gpio.h 0 additions, 23 deletionsarch/arm/mach-mmp/include/mach/gpio.h
- arch/arm/mach-mmp/jasper.c 0 additions, 1 deletionarch/arm/mach-mmp/jasper.c
- arch/arm/mach-mmp/mmp2.c 1 addition, 1 deletionarch/arm/mach-mmp/mmp2.c
- arch/arm/mach-mmp/pxa168.c 1 addition, 1 deletionarch/arm/mach-mmp/pxa168.c
- arch/arm/mach-mmp/pxa910.c 1 addition, 1 deletionarch/arm/mach-mmp/pxa910.c
- arch/arm/mach-mmp/tavorevb.c 1 addition, 0 deletionsarch/arm/mach-mmp/tavorevb.c
- arch/arm/mach-pxa/cm-x255.c 0 additions, 1 deletionarch/arm/mach-pxa/cm-x255.c
- arch/arm/mach-pxa/include/mach/gpio-pxa.h 133 additions, 0 deletionsarch/arm/mach-pxa/include/mach/gpio-pxa.h
- arch/arm/mach-pxa/include/mach/gpio.h 2 additions, 108 deletionsarch/arm/mach-pxa/include/mach/gpio.h
- arch/arm/mach-pxa/include/mach/littleton.h 1 addition, 1 deletionarch/arm/mach-pxa/include/mach/littleton.h
- arch/arm/mach-pxa/irq.c 1 addition, 1 deletionarch/arm/mach-pxa/irq.c
- arch/arm/mach-pxa/mfp-pxa2xx.c 1 addition, 0 deletionsarch/arm/mach-pxa/mfp-pxa2xx.c
- arch/arm/mach-pxa/pxa25x.c 1 addition, 0 deletionsarch/arm/mach-pxa/pxa25x.c
- arch/arm/mach-pxa/pxa27x.c 1 addition, 0 deletionsarch/arm/mach-pxa/pxa27x.c
- arch/arm/mach-pxa/pxa3xx.c 1 addition, 1 deletionarch/arm/mach-pxa/pxa3xx.c
- arch/arm/mach-pxa/pxa95x.c 1 addition, 1 deletionarch/arm/mach-pxa/pxa95x.c
Loading
Please register or sign in to comment